India vs Namibia t20 world cup match today: The T20 World Cup match between India and Namibia will be played in Delhi today. This match will be held at Arun Jaitley Stadium from 7:00 pm. The Indian team has defeated USA in its first match. Team India’s morale is high and Suryakumar Yadav and company are looking towards their second consecutive victory. Abhishek Sharma has been discharged from the hospital. But he will not be seen playing against Namibia. In his place, Sanju Samson will open with Ishan Kishan.

New Delhi. The team management including head coach Gautam Gambhir is worried due to Abhishek Sharma being ill. Because this has affected their planning. There is no threat to India in the T20 World Cup match against Namibia, but this match is very important for Team India before the big match to be played against Pakistan on 15th February. Against Namibia, Indian players will get a chance to strengthen their preparations against Pakistan. The teams of India and Namibia will clash today i.e. Thursday at 7 pm at the Arun Jaitley Stadium in Delhi. In place of Abhishek, Sanju Samson will be fielded in the opening in place of Ishan Kishan.
In the first match against America, the batsmen were not able to perform as expected on the sticky pitch of Wankhede. Now he would like to show an aggressive game on the Feroz Shah Kotla pitch, which can be called an excellent pitch for batting. India has the upper hand against Namibia, whose team could not perform well against Netherlands on the same ground. If India wins the toss, then it would like to bat first so that its batsmen can get adequate opportunities. Namibia’s bowling attack is not special and any team playing in the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y can remind them of Chhathi’s milk.

Although Abhishek has been discharged from the hospital due to stomach infection and viral fever, it would not be appropriate to field him to give him a chance to recover completely before the big match against Pakistan on Sunday. Because Abhishek’s presence in that match will prove to be an important challenge for the opposition team. The match against Namibia can prove to be a golden opportunity for Sanju Samson, who was struggling with poor form, to get back into form, because due to continuous failures, he lost his place to Ishan Kishan, who is in great form at the moment.
In the press conference before the match, assistant coach Ryan ten Doeschate said, ‘Sanju is feeling good and is understanding his role in the team in place of the injured player. He is a kind person, he treats the team well, he is practicing well and that is what we expect from all of us in the team. Stopping India’s strong batting will be a tough challenge for Namibia. It will be even more challenging for their batsmen to face the balls of Jasprit Bumrah, Arshdeep Singh, Varun Chakraborty and Hardik Pandya.
Among Namibia’s top six batsmen, only all-rounder JJ Smit has a strike rate above 140. Facing Chakravarthy could be a big challenge for the Namibian team as they do not usually face bowlers of such high quality. The International Cricket Council (ICC) scheduling team ensured that, except for the commercially important match against Pakistan, India’s league stage matches would be against teams that would also lose to India’s A, B or C teams in this format. After playing the match with Namibia, the Indian team will fly to Colombo where it has to face Pakistan on Sunday.
